Output 503068a97f3cbfe6843e8d66aa0e2e7f9c9f6ed30f77f29c4ae192b38a309b6b:30

value
274806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ec1abe2c5a6c7b36b343db1cdebcb7f3b46dd44 OP_EQUALVERIFY OP_CHECKSIG
address
1E1pxmUEasL5nCnmgDJiarMpw4SFQoGDE8
transaction
503068a97f3cbfe6843e8d66aa0e2e7f9c9f6ed30f77f29c4ae192b38a309b6b
confirmations
169573
spent
true